Attentive Symptoms

Everyone struggles to stay focused on an activity from time to moment, but if you are struggling with symptoms of attention deficit disorder as an adult this can be particularly disruptive to your personal and professional life. You may be late for appointments, lose things frequently and have difficulty making commitments to others. You may even have a hard time keeping the track of your finances or [Redirect-302] returning phone calls. It's normal to have trouble paying attention, but if your ADHD symptoms affect your daily activities or your standard of living it's worth looking into the options for treating it.

Inattention ADHD symptoms include difficulty staying on task and not being able to pay attention to the minute details, losing things important to you and forgetfulness. It can be difficult to read lengthy documents or stay focused in lectures and meetings at work. You may struggle to complete schoolwork or home projects and make a few mistakes that can lead to serious consequences. You may also get distracted by interruptions or noise and your mind is racing ahead before you've finished listening.

While hyperactivity-impulsive ADHD tends to decrease as children grow into teens, inattentive symptoms Of adhd in adults quiz often persist into adulthood. There are many risk factors that contribute to inattention ADHD, including genetics, birth complications such as low birth weight exposure to toxins in pregnancy and pre-school, low educational achievement and poverty.

If you're struggling with inattentive ADHD symptoms, it's helpful to keep a diary of your challenges and develop strategies to address these issues. You can also solicit help from family and friends to help you, and also find an ADHD specialist who can teach you specific techniques to increase your ability to control your symptoms. Combination Symptoms

If a person has both inattentive and hyperactive/impulsive symptoms, they are considered to have combined uncommon adhd symptoms. This is the most common type of ADHD. This kind of ADHD is marked by an inability to focus and difficulty staying on task. They are easily distracted and frequently leave work unfinished or misplace their things. They may fidget a lot or talk a great deal during work meetings, and have trouble sitting still in class. They may also have difficulty waiting to be called upon in conversations. People who are impulsive might answer questions before they have listened to the whole question or rush to start games or activities if it's not their turn.

People who have a mostly inattentional ADHD often are misunderstood and don't get the assistance they need. Teachers or family members might dismiss them as lazy or apathetic. They might feel angry due to the fact that they're not able to complete their homework or keep up with chores however they're unaware of the problem. More women than men are at risk.

Those with mainly hyperactive/impulsive ADHD are more easily recognized by others, but their problems can be harder to treat. They're more likely to have depression and anxiety disorders than people who have primarily inattentive ADHD and can have more issues with relationships and low self-esteem than those who have only inattentive ADHD.

A health care provider or mental health professional needs to do a thorough evaluation to determine the cause of the symptoms, establish diagnoses and determine the most effective solutions. This includes looking at the person's mood, medical history, and any other physical or mental illnesses they suffer from. They might also interview relatives, friends and coworkers about the person's behavior at home and at work.

Adults with attention deficit disorder can be treated with therapy, medication or lifestyle modifications. Behavioral therapy helps them learn to manage their symptoms and improve the quality of their lives. It could include cognitive therapies, which assist people to change their negative thoughts as well as psychotherapy or talk therapy.
